In most Indian households, the day begins before the sun rises. The morning routine is a finely tuned choreography where multiple generations navigate shared spaces.

The structure of the Indian family is evolving, but its core remains deeply communal. While traditional joint families—where grandparents, parents, aunts, uncles, and cousins live under one roof—are becoming less common in metro cities, the "extended nuclear family" has taken its place. Even when living in separate apartments, families usually choose to reside in the same neighborhood or building complex.

The government's decision to block the site was seen by many as a regressive act of internet censorship. Critics, including graphic novelist Sarnath Banerjee, questioned where this would lead, comparing India to nations like China and North Korea. The ban sparked a significant debate about the state's role in policing online "obscenity" versus the constitutional guarantee of free speech. For many, the character became a symbol of resistance against state overreach.
